Winter Sports Resorts
Ice Planet Hoth (The Empire Strikes Back)

Forget Chamonix; this winter there's only one destination for the powder crowd. That's right, Hoth is the gnarly new winter spot, where despite unforgiving terrain, year-round sub-zero temperatures and nosey probe droids, Rebel Alliance hipsters are flocking to the ice planet du jour to ski the most incredible slopes in the galaxy. Boarding, skiing, lugeing, tauntaun riding� it's all here. Word of warning though: apr�s-ski is pretty limited, the local wildlife will eat you, and there may be AT-ATs on the blue run. Keep your wits about you and stay frosty!

For an alternative winter break, hit the slopes of Rura Penthe, the Klingon Empire's up-and-coming penal asteroid. Think Butlins with more Klingons.
